Abstract
The invention discloses a kind of intelligent parking system based on cloud platform, the system includes:Cloud platform acquisition module, the target position information for obtaining user's upload;Cloud platform parking stall searching modul, for searching idle parking stall in the pre-determined distance of the target location uploaded in user, and sends the idle parking space information found to user;Parking stall selection reservation module, confirms for browsing idle parking space information laggard driving position selection driving position reservation of going forward side by side for user, and reservation confirmation in selection parking stall is sent into cloud platform, and the parking stall reservation confirmation includes reservation parking stall position;Cloud platform route planning module, the parking stall reservation confirmation for being sent according to user carries out parking stall reservation, and is that user is planned for up to reservation parking stall position route according to optimal policy.

Embodiment
Reference picture 1, a kind of intelligent parking system based on cloud platform proposed by the present invention, including:
Cloud platform acquisition module, the target position information for obtaining user's upload;
User connects cloud platform by mobile phone or mobile communication equipment;
In the present embodiment, when user reaches or will arrived at, user passes through mobile phone or mobile communication equipment
Input the target position information of destination.
Cloud platform parking stall searching modul, for searching idle parking stall in the pre-determined distance of the target location uploaded in user,
And the idle parking space information found is sent to user;
Cloud platform parking stall searching modul, specifically for:In the target location uploaded using user as the center of circle, pre-determined distance is half
Idle parking stall is searched in the region in footpath;
Wherein, the pre-determined distance can be by user's real-time edition;
Cloud platform parking stall searching modul, is additionally operable to:The idle parking space information found, the idle parking stall are sent to user
Information includes:Whether parking stall geographical position, idle parking stall are reserved, parking stall Parking Fee, parking stall can down time;
In the present embodiment, preset as the center of circle target location uploaded according to user, the target location uploaded using user
Distance sends the idle parking space information found to user to search idle parking stall in the region of radius, when in pre-determined distance
When not finding idle parking stall in the region of planning, user can real-time edition pre-determined distance expansion seeking scope.
Parking stall selection reservation module, it is pre- for browsing idle parking space information laggard driving position selection driving position of going forward side by side for user
About confirm, and reservation confirmation in selection parking stall is sent to cloud platform, the parking stall reservation confirmation includes reservation parking stall
Position;
Parking stall selection reservation module, specifically for:Reservation confirmation in selection parking stall is sent to cloud platform, the parking stall
Confirmation is preengage, in addition to:E.T.A, automatically cancellation time, estimated pick-up time;
In the present embodiment, after user browses idle parking space information, the traffic conditions and car around destination are understood
Position situation, in the case of the anxiety of parking stall, carries out parking stall and preengages in advance, and parking stall reservation confirmation will be selected to be sent to cloud and put down
Platform, the parking stall reservation confirmation includes:When preengaging parking stall position, E.T.A, cancelling time, estimated pick-up automatically
Between, it is necessary to which explanation, automatic to cancel the pre- of user when user does not reach reservation parking stall position before the automatic cancellation time
About, prevent user occupancy parking stall from causing other users not preengage.
Cloud platform route planning module, the parking stall reservation confirmation for being sent according to user carries out parking stall reservation, and
It is that user is planned for up to reservation parking stall position route according to optimal policy.
Cloud platform route planning module, specifically for:It is that user is planned for up to reservation parking stall route, tool according to optimal policy
Body includes:
Obtain user current location;
Architectural plan, current traffic situation are advised for user according to where user current location, reservation parking stall position, parking stall
Draw and reach reservation parking stall position route;
In the present embodiment, it is different with building structure for the position in different parking lots, with reference to user current location, in advance
Architectural plan, current traffic situation are that user is planned for up to reservation parking stall position route about where parking stall position, parking stall, including
It is that user saves the plenty of time from which door enters, which way to go line traffic lights are few, traffic is good.
Present embodiment is searched empty by obtaining the target position information that user uploads in the pre-determined distance of target location
Not busy parking stall, browses the laggard driving position of idle parking space information for user and selects driving position reservation confirmation of going forward side by side, cloud platform is according to user
The parking stall reservation confirmation of transmission carries out parking stall reservation, and is built according to where user current location, reservation parking stall position, parking stall
Build plan, current traffic situation to be planned for up to reservation parking stall position route for user, in this way, when user reaches or will reach
During destination, the traffic conditions and parking stall situation around destination can be understood in real time, in the case of the anxiety of parking stall, carry out parking stall
Preengaging in advance, it is not necessary to looked for because can not find parking stall when walking, so both having saved the time while alleviating traffic congestion, simultaneously
Know the expense and the means of payment of parking spot in advance, be that car owner brings very big facility, for different parking lots position and
Building structure is different, and architectural plan, current traffic situation with reference to where reservation parking stall position, parking stall are that user is planned for up to pre-
About parking stall position route, including from which door enters, which way to go line traffic lights are few, traffic is good, it is a large amount of to be that user saves
Time.
